Team,

We rotated the internal key for the Brimble catalog cache-invalidation service at 09:00. Old key stops working tonight. If stale product pages are reported, trigger a manual flush via the admin panel first; don't escalate unless the flush fails twice. Update your local tooling with the new key below.

gateway credential: kto23_LX9A4ys6i4nzHtpOLNLodKK

Runbook: Account Recovery — post stale-cache incident

Context: the Wrenfold stale-cache bug served expired session tokens, locking several staff accounts. Release manager steps: freeze the deploy train, purge the session cache tier, confirm cache TTLs match the postmortem's corrected values, then re-enable sign-in. Verify no stale entries remain via the audit sweep. Locked accounts are restored through the recovery console, one batch at a time. The console will not accept batches until you enter the recovery passphrase shown below.

vault phrase of bagaf-kajeg = jorath-feniel-briir-siliel-ralix

Subject: Support Outsourcing — Heads-up

Team, quick note before Friday. We're moving tier-one customer support to Quillbright Services starting next quarter. Our in-house crew shifts to escalations only. Expect a few bumpy weeks; please keep clients reassured but don't share specifics yet. Marta is drafting talking points. The thinking behind the move is in the confidential note below.

confidential, tadup-bagep: The steering committee signed off on a budget of $3.4 million for Project Quenwyn. The renewal with Casvanix Foods closes at $34.0 million a year, 42 percent above the last contract.